Gradener / Pollick / Rabl - Orchestral Music 1 (CD)

Gradener / Pollick / Rabl - Orchestral Music 1 (CD)

The German-born, Vienna-based Hermann Gradener (1844-1929) is yet another composer whose music, esteemed in it's own time, has since slipped between the floorboards of history. Yet this first recording of his two violin concertos - substantial works both, downstream from Brahms, and with a hint of Sibelius - prove him to have been one of the more important Romantics, with a strong sense of drama, a sure hand for musical architecture and a natural flair for extended melody. The conductor of this recording, Gottfried Rabl, discovered Gradener's scores in the second-hand section of a Viennese music-shop many years ago and now, joined by the American violinist Karen Bentley Pollick, they are releasing this first album in a series intended to put Gradener's music before the modern public for the first time.
